Wrap block of tofu in paper towels or a clean dish towel and squeeze out as much water as you can. If you have the time, use a tofu press for 30Min to remove excess liquid.
Cube the tofu and throw in a large bowl along with the cornstarch, salt, and pepper. Toss until coated.
Add vegetable oil to a large pan on medium-high heat. Fry the tofu until crispy and golden brown. I do this in batches to make sure they evenly brown. Remove tofu from the pan and place on a wire rack.
Large dice the red bell pepper and add to the same pan. Cook until charred and soft. Add in the diced pineapple and cook for an additional 2-3 minutes.
Whisk together all the sauce ingredients and add to the pan with red bell pepper and pineapple. Cook for 1-2 minutes until it starts to bubble and thicken. Toss in tofu and coat evenly.
Serve the Sweet & Sour Tofu with your choice of white or brown rice and top with thinly sliced scallions. Enjoy!
